你查询的IP:[121.51.38.199]  地理位置:中国–上海–上海

最新查询122.119.20.7 123.180.255.107 122.102.252.169 222.32.155.17 123.4.46.9 121.4.70.211 119.96.187.135 218.64.173.107 202.70.216.183 121.51.38.199 221.133.224.225 116.128.172.213 117.103.128.84 124.156.184.170 219.128.74.126 119.41.214.239 202.38.140.229 202.125.176.206 119.16.254.137 119.31.192.54 125.32.5.207 210.76.214.248 118.180.134.20 203.135.96.60 121.224.34.143 203.191.16.73 59.32.166.61 61.240.78.171 220.112.2.255 124.172.238.165 210.28.154.80